Swiss International Air Lines (SWISS) will be further adjusting its range of services from Zurich and Geneva in its 2016 summer schedules. Alicante in Spain will receive scheduled service from Zurich, while the vacation destination of Lamezia Terme in Southern Italy will be served from Geneva. The new summer schedules will also see frequencies increased to various existing European and intercontinental destinations. And the new Boeing 777-300ER will be introduced onto a number of routes in the course of the summer timetable period. SWISS will serve 102 destinations in 46 countries in its new summer schedules, which come into effect at the end of March.

On the long-haul network, SWISS will be gradually raising its frequencies to Boston. As a result, the self-styled “Hub of the Universe” will be served by up to two daily flights in the peak summer season.

New Boeing 777-300ERs for ultra-long-haul routes
Flights to a range of long-haul destinations will be switched to operation with the new Boeing 777-300ER in the course of the summer timetable period. SWISS’s new fleet flagship will be deployed on services between Zurich and Bangkok, Hong Kong, Los Angeles, Montreal, San Francisco, Sao Paulo and Tel Aviv.

New services from Geneva, too
SWISS’s Geneva-based network will see the new addition of Lamezia Terme in Southern Italy, which will receive a seasonal weekly flight from Geneva in July and August. Service on the Geneva-Valencia route will be raised to up to four weekly flights; and frequencies to Ajaccio, Biarritz and Calvi will also be increased. Services will also be intensified from Geneva to destinations in Portugal and on the Greek islands, in response to the generally higher demand on these routes in the summer months.

SWISS will serve 102 destinations (76 European and 26 intercontinental) in 46 countries in its 2016 summer schedules. The new summer timetable will be valid from 27 March to 29 October 2016.

Edelweiss to add Rio de Janeiro
SWISS will also be offering services to new vacation destinations in collaboration with its sister carrier Edelweiss in the 2016 summer timetable period. Edelweiss is further expanding its long-haul network, and will offer two weekly services to the Olympic city of Rio de Janeiro from the end of April. Edelweiss will also be adding a further Canadian destination to its network: Calgary, the gateway to the Rockies, will be served twice weekly from Zurich from the end of May. Two further leisure destinations will also be added to Edelweiss’s short-haul network from June onwards: Seville (Spain) and Pula (Croatia), which each receive two weekly services. Flights to both will be bookable from 17 March.
